Tranquility

Insanity, Instability, a touch of vertigo. Trees rustling, clouds flying, a night so dark no stars can shine. Feet planted on earth so solid, anchored down a weight so heavy. Darkness settles as a cricket chirps- Silence shattered, winds howling, all quiet lost, swept away in a moment so great. Clarity, Epiphany, a touch of stability. A moon so bright peeking through the clouds, thin shafts of light illuminate the darkness. a shaking of shoulders, a release of burden. turmoil ceases it's muted roar, tranquility and peace eclipses this night. footsteps light on the path to follow, surety in step for the moment has passed. ©K.
